Matthew Malehorn is a scholar working on Hematology, Oncology and Cell Biology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Matthew Malehorn has authored 5 papers receiving a total of 866 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Hematology, 2 papers in Oncology and 1 paper in Cell Biology. Recurrent topics in Matthew Malehorn’s work include Hematopoietic Stem Cell Transplantation (3 papers), Immune Cell Function and Interaction (1 paper) and R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(1 paper). Matthew Malehorn is often cited by papers focused on Hematopoietic Stem Cell Transplantation (3 papers), Immune Cell Function and Interaction (1 paper) and R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(1 paper). Matthew Malehorn collaborates with scholars based in United States. Matthew Malehorn's co-authors include Curt I. Civin, James Barber, Vivek Tanavde, Elizabeth S. Garrett and Linzhao Cheng and has published in prestigious journals such as Blood, Cancer Research and Molecular Therapy.
